We started BLW with green beens, cucumber, carrots (raw and cooked) cold stuff is good for teething then toast, rice cakes, cream cheese! From 6 months they say they can just have what you have... But not honey or whole nuts. Just watch salt content! Phoebe loved a jacket potato with beans :) it's so east just to dump some of my dinner on her tray!

BLW was a good option for us also as Phoebe has jumped up with weight so if we had fed her with spoon and jars then she would have kept piling on. This way she is exploring but she eats more now than when we started.
